What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Mail Recovery Center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Mail Recovery Center Specialist, you need str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with mail tracking software, barcode scanners, and USPS systems is typically required. Dependability,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ication help you efficiently process and resolve undeliverable mail. These skills are vital for ensuring lost or misdirected mail is accurately identified and returned, maintaining customer trust and operational efficiency.

What are some typical challenges faced by employees working at a Mail Recovery Center, and how can they be managed?

Employees at a Mail Recovery Center often handle large volumes of undeliverable or lost mail, which can be both physically demanding and detail-oriented. A common challenge is accurately identifying and processing items with incomplete or damaged labels, requiring patience and strong problem-solving skills. Team members must also maintain meticulous records and adhere to confidentiality policies, as they may encounter sensitive or valuable items. Effective communication and collaboration with other postal departments help ensure items are properly sorted and, if possible, returned to their rightful owners.

What is a Mail Recovery Center?

A Mail Recovery Center (MRC) is a facility operated by the United States Postal Service (USPS) that handles undeliverable mail that cannot be returned to the sender or delivered to the recipient. These centers process items that are missing labels, have damaged packaging, or lack sufficient address information. The MRC attempts to reunite lost mail with its rightful owners through research and various recovery processes. If recovery is not possible, valuable items may be auctioned, while other items are disposed of according to postal regulations.

Job description

Receptionist - Recovery | Anabranch Recovery Center | Terre Haute, Indiana

About the Job:

The Receptionist is responsible for greeting and assisting all visitors, employees, answering the switchboard, responding to inquiries, connecting caller with appropriate party, paging overhead when appropriate, documenting incoming deliveries, processing incoming and outgoing mail and providing additional clerical support as requested.

Roles and Responsibilities:

Operates switchboard, answers, transfers, and disseminates all incoming calls to appropriate people in a professional and courteous manner and takes messages.

Pages individuals over the central paging system as requested and according to facility policy.

Greets, welcomes, and directs individuals entering the Facility promptly, assuring that all visitors, vendors and other guests are registered in the facility visitor's log.

Provides assistance to clients and employees, such as making change, checking valuables, providing meal tickets, and providing postage as requested.

Sorts and delivers incoming mail and sends outgoing mail on a timely basis.

Handles facility inquiries and provide general information.

Maintains petty cash fund.

Receives and documents deliveries

Performs cash receipt batch write-up including G/L coding.

Accepts payments on client accounts and writes receipts.

Notifies facility staff of visitor's arrival.

Maintains security by following established procedures including monitoring guest logbook and issuing visitor badges, if required.

Performs data entry as assigned.

Provides clerical support to other departments, as needed.

High School diploma or equivalent required.

At least one year related experience preferred.
